The Magic defeated the Mavericks, 138-127 tonight in Dallas. Wendell Carter Jr. contributed a team-high 28 points to go with 6 rebounds 3 assists and 2 three pointers, with Desmond Bane of the Magic adding an additional 27 points (8-13 FG, 3-5 3P) and 5 assists in the game. Cooper Flagg finished with a team-high 51 points along with 6 rebounds for the Mavericks in the losing effort. The Magic improve their record to 41-36 with the win, while the Mavericks fall to 24-53 for the season.

Flagg tonight: Career-high 51 PTS | career-high 6 3PM | 6 REB | 3 AST | 19-30 FG

Cooper Flagg is the first teenager and youngest player in NBA history to score 50+ PTS in a game. He now has the two highest-scoring games as a teenager ever after scoring 49 on Jan. 29 v the Hornets and becomes the 9th rookie in NBA history to score 50+ points in a game.
